Dark mode is nothing but an un-illuminated interface. If you are an avid Instagram user, you may understand the dark mode as they recently equipped this feature.

Generally, we all use black text on a white back ground. But dark mode is exactly opposite to that.

As there is consensual opinion growing day by day across the developers of operating systems, websites, themes and apps that the bright screen glow can cause harm to eyes eventually.

Just to soothe the eyes, it is a great solution to use dark mode as opined the people who constantly work on glowing gadgets.
